The Blackness of a Deep Sleep
by
Alisha Morgan

Black --
Yes, that's what it needs to be
If Black doesn't show -- I do hope he will! --
But, with no such sign, there will be an insanity
plea.
Without Black, I might as well be mentally ill.
And what of the Noise?
That I can not stand!
Does it not know of what it destroys?
Time crumbles away, past each hour hand.
I am with Noise, though I wish it were not so
And without Black -- seems He likes to tease --
Of the time, I have no desire to know
It all just wastes away, with a certain expertise.
Still I lay here, hoping for a little more,
Perhaps a little less, as well...
I feel it coming, esprit de corps!
I'm beginning to hear the words of farewell
At last! Black is nearly here,
Almost here, he is coming, at long last!
No one is to interfere,
Sleep will now take over en masse.
